WebApr 12, 2024 · Edmund was finally defeated at the Battle of Assandun, which is thought to have occurred at Ashingdon Hill in south-east Essex. After Cnut's victory, Edmund agreed to divide the country, keeping Wessex and allowing Cnut to take the rest of England.
